Key Ingredients
To create these miniature gastronomic wonders, you will need the following ingredients:
🍞 1 package of mini pizza crusts or cookies
🧀 1 cup of mascarpone cheese
🍓 1 cup of strawberries, hulled and sliced
🫐 1 cup of blueberries
🍎 1 apple, peeled and diced
🌿 1/4 cup of fresh mint leaves
🍯 2 tablespoons of honey
🥛 1 tablespoon of lemon juice
Instructions
1️⃣ Begin by preparing your mini pizza crusts. If using homemade dough, roll it out to about 1/4 inch thickness and cut into circles or use a cookie cutter to create fun shapes. Bake according to your recipe or package instructions until lightly golden. Allow the crusts to cool completely.
2️⃣ In a medium bowl, mix together the mascarpone cheese, honey, and lemon juice until smooth. This will be the base of your fruit pizzas, providing a creamy contrast to the crunchy fruits.
3️⃣ Arrange your cooled crusts on a serving platter or individual plates. Spread a small amount of the mascarpone mixture onto each crust, leaving a small border around the edges to prevent the toppings from overflowing.
4️⃣ Top each mini pizza with a slice of strawberry for the “red” component, a few blueberries for the “blue,” and a piece or two of diced apple for the “white.” The combination of these fruits not only adheres to the patriotic theme but also offers a delightful mix of textures and flavors.
5️⃣ Garnish with a fresh mint leaf. The freshness of the mint adds a sophisticated touch to the dish, balancing out the sweetness of the fruits and cheese.
6️⃣ Serve immediately, or cover and refrigerate for up to 2 hours before serving. This allows the flavors to meld together and the crusts to retain their crunch.

Heat Control
Given that these mini fruit pizzas involve baked crusts, it’s crucial to monitor the temperature to achieve the perfect crunch without overbaking. A temperature of 375°F (190°C) is ideal for baking the crusts, and keeping an eye on them after the 5-7 minute mark can help prevent overcooking. The goal is to have crusts that are lightly golden and still retain some crispiness.

Storage Tips
If you find yourself with leftovers, store the assembled fruit pizzas in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. However, for the best results, it’s recommended to assemble the pizzas just before serving to maintain the freshness and crunch of the ingredients. If you’ve prepared the components separately (crusts, mascarpone mixture, and cut fruits), these can be stored in separate airtight containers in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.

Troubleshooting
- Issue: Overbaked crusts.
- Fix: Reduce oven temperature or baking time. Check the crusts frequently during the baking process.
- Issue: Mascarpone mixture too runny.
- Fix: Refrigerate the mixture for about 30 minutes to firm it up before using.
- Issue: Fruits not fresh.
- Fix: Use the freshest fruits available. Consider shopping at local farmers’ markets for the best seasonal produce.
FAQ
- Q: Can I use other types of cheese for the base?
- A: Yes, while mascarpone provides a unique flavor, you can experiment with other creamy cheeses like ricotta or cream cheese for different flavor profiles.
- Q: How do I prevent the crusts from becoming soggy?
- A: Assemble the fruit pizzas just before serving, and make sure the crusts are completely cooled before topping.
- Q: Are these suitable for outdoor events?
- A: Yes, they are perfect for outdoor gatherings. Just ensure to keep them refrigerated until serving and consume within a few hours of assembly.
- Q: Can I make these in advance?
- A: While it’s best to assemble the pizzas just before serving, you can prepare the components (crusts, mascarpone mixture, cut fruits) ahead of time and store them in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
- Q: Are there any vegan alternatives?
- A: Yes, consider using a vegan cream cheese alternative for the base and ensure that the crusts are vegan-friendly. Fresh fruits are naturally vegan, making this a versatile dessert for various dietary needs.

Star Spangled Morsels of Fresh Fruit and Flair on Miniature Pastry Canvases
A festive and colorful dessert featuring fresh fruits arranged on delicate pastry canvases, perfect for celebrations.
Ingredients
- 1 sheet puff pastry, thawed
- 2 cups mixed fresh berries (strawberries, blueberries, raspberries)
- 1/4 cup powdered sugar
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/2 cup whipped cream
- Fresh mint leaves for garnish
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 200u00b0C (400u00b0F). Roll out the thawed puff pastry on a lightly floured surface and cut it into 4 equal squares.
- Place the pastry squares on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Prick the centers with a fork, leaving a 1-inch border around the edges. Bake for 15-20 minutes until golden brown and puffed.
- While the pastry is baking, prepare the berry mixture. In a medium bowl, combine the mixed berries, powdered sugar, lemon juice, and vanilla extract. Gently toss to coat the berries and set aside.
- Once the pastry squares are done, remove them from the oven and allow them to cool slightly. Use the back of a spoon to press down the centers, creating a shallow well.
- Fill each pastry square with a generous scoop of the berry mixture, and top with a dollop of whipped cream.
- Garnish with fresh mint leaves and serve immediately for a delightful presentation.
Tips
- For an extra touch, drizzle a little chocolate sauce over the top before serving.
- Make sure the puff pastry is cold when you roll it out for the best texture.
